In Issue #903 the rule in my opinion correctly throws on a += for simple defined arrays using the $var = @() method of defining an array to the var variable
I would suggest that a new rule is created that correctly identifies this method as being an expensive action and that a recommendation to use a fully defined Array collection would be a better suggestion, initially suggesting using a System.Collections.ArrayList
This rule should look for both @() & += and suggest converting these calls better scripting practices
